《python从入门到精通》——生成由数字、字母组成的4位验证码
生活随笔
收集整理的這篇文章主要介紹了
《python从入门到精通》——生成由数字、字母组成的4位验证码
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
效果
代碼實(shí)現(xiàn)
import random #導(dǎo)入標(biāo)準(zhǔn)模塊中的random if __name__=='__main__':checkcode="" #保存驗(yàn)證碼的變量for i in range(4): #循環(huán)四次index=random.randrange(0,4) #生成0-3中的一個(gè)數(shù)if index !=i and index+1 !=i:checkcode+=chr(random.randint(97,122)) #生成a-z中的一個(gè)小寫字母elif index+1==i:checkcode+=chr(random.randint(65,90)) #生成A-Z中的一個(gè)大寫字母else:checkcode+=str(random.randint(1,9)) #生成1-9中的一個(gè)數(shù)字print("驗(yàn)證碼:",checkcode) #輸出生成的驗(yàn)證碼總結(jié)
以上是生活随笔為你收集整理的《python从入门到精通》——生成由数字、字母组成的4位验证码的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 《算法学习与应用 从入门到精通》——填
- 下一篇: 《python从入门到精通》——使用位移